How much do paper mill j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 21, 2026, the average hourly pay for paper mill in Rhinelander, WI is $19.42,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.92 and $21.83 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Paper Mill vs Paper Machine Operator?

AspectPaper MillPaper Machine Operator
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; technical training often preferredHigh school diploma; on-the-job training or technical certification
Work EnvironmentFactories or manufacturing plants, often noisy and industrialInside paper machines, working on production lines in industrial settings
Industry UsageBroad term encompassing various roles in paper manufacturingSpecific role focused on operating paper machines
Job FocusOversees entire paper production process or manages multiple rolesOperates and monitors paper machines to produce quality paper

While a Paper Mill refers to the entire manufacturing facility producing paper, a Paper Machine Operator is a specific role within that facility responsible for running the paper machines. The operator ensures smooth operation and quality control, whereas the mill encompasses all processes and staff involved in paper production.

What Are the Qualifications to Work in a Paper Mill?

The qualifications needed to work in a paper mill depend on your responsibilities. To be a mill operator, you need to have a high school diploma or GED certificate, as well as job training under more experienced machine operators. You also need excellent mechanical and technical problem-solving skills. Managers typically have several years of experience working in a mill, including at least a year in a supervisory position. Quality control workers need to have a strong grasp of the technical specifications of the materials and paper goods they inspect and knowledge of regulatory compliance. Service technicians need mechanical training and strong computer skills.

What are some common challenges faced by employees working in a paper mill, and how can they be managed?

Working in a paper mill often involves managing heavy machinery, maintaining safety standards, and handling repetitive tasks in a fast-paced environment. Employees may face challenges such as exposure to noise, dust, and varying temperatures, as well as the need for constant attention to detail to avoid equipment malfunctions. To manage these challenges, it's important to follow safety protocols, use personal protective equipment (PPE), and participate in regular training sessions. Teamwork and clear communication with supervisors and coworkers also play a vital role in maintaining a safe and productive workspace.

What are paper mill workers?

Paper mill workers are employees who operate and maintain the machinery used to manufacture paper products from raw materials like wood pulp or recycled paper. Their responsibilities include monitoring production processes, ensuring quality standards, performing maintenance, and troubleshooting equipment. Paper mill workers often work in teams and may specialize in areas such as pulping, papermaking, or finishing. The role requires attention to safety protocols due to the use of heavy machinery and chemicals.

The Paper Mill Supervisor has overall responsibility for managing the daily activities of on-shift crews in the paper mill, including directing shift maintenance demands for operating the business. This is a key position that works closely with other mill shift supervisors to ensure employee safety, quality, maintenance, and productivity goals are met. The Paper Mill Supervisor provides management leadership across the mill during off hours, on nights, and weekends, acting as a key member of the mill's emergency response process.
Responsibilities
  • Must follow Ahlstrom's manufacturing and hygiene processes, procedures and policies, as applicable, to the position's areas of responsibility, in order to meet and maintain the safety, quality, and regulatory compliance requirements for each grade of paper.
  • Administer consistent application of all company policies.
  • Ensure on-shift performance meets work standards.
  • Communicate expectations to employees and evaluate performance. Address individual or crew underperformance and take appropriate action. Responsible for productivity, quality, efficiency, cost control. compliance, and housekeeping.
  • Provide crews with needed equipment and training resources; provide guidance to foster individual growth.
  • Assist department trainers in making sure employees' training requirements are completed.
  • Participate and/or lead identified daily production meetings and monthly crew meetings.
  • Audit crews to ensure they are working safely, following safety requirements, and are able to identify potential hazards. Appropriately correct safety hazards and unsafe acts in a timely manner.
  • Lead safety investigations.
  • Assess processes for effectiveness and implement improvements.
  • Provide leadership in emergency situations.
